&lt;div&gt;One presentational point makes this considerably easier to defend. Put the limitations on the first page rather than in a footnote. A report that opens by stating what cannot be measured is read as careful, while the same information discovered later is read as something that was concealed, and the difference determines how the numbers around it are treated.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;Verify the Fix Without Fooling Yourself Re-ask the same four questions quarterly rather than weekly, from a fresh signed out session. Identity work has slow feedback because scattered sources have to be re-crawled before the picture updates, and checking too often produces noise that looks like failure.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;One thing worth measuring separately is how recent your reviews are relative to your competitors on the same platform. Volume comparisons are the usual instinct and recency is the more informative one, because a profile with steady recent activity describes a business as it operates now while a larger historic total describes one that used to be busy.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;Keep a record of what you predicted as well as what you measured. Writing down at the start of a quarter what you expect to move, and then reading it back at the end, is the cheapest way to find out whether your model of this channel is any good. Most teams never do it, which is why the same confident explanations survive for years without ever being tested.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;Give journalists and analysts accurate material to work from, in a form they can use without rewriting. Where an independent comparison exists and gets your details wrong, a polite factual correction is accepted far more often than people expect, because publishers generally do not want to be wrong.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;Run a commercial prompt in almost any category and look at what gets cited. Review platforms, roundups and comparison sites appear first and most often, and the brands being discussed appear well down the list if at all.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;The condition is that the output has to be yours to keep and act on elsewhere, including the prompt set. An audit that only makes sense inside that agency&#039;s retainer is a sales document with a price attached.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;Where you do name people, make the association reciprocal. Your site names the profile, the profile links back, and ideally some independent source associates the two without either of you arranging it.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;What You Can Do Legitimately More than most teams assume. Claim every profile that allows it and complete it properly. Correct factual errors on platforms that accept corrections, which most do when you have evidence. Respond to reviews, including critical ones, since an unanswered complaint reads as inattention.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;It is also worth doing while your category is boring. An audit run during a period of stability produces a clean baseline. One run in the middle of a competitor&#039;s campaign or immediately after a site migration measures the disruption rather than the position, and you will not know which you have unless you took the earlier reading.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;The hardest thing to accept about this channel is that most of the work sits on pages you cannot edit. Marketing teams are organised around owned properties, and the citations that produce recommendations mostly point somewhere else.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;The Structural Reason A system composing a recommendation needs to weigh several options against each other. A review site has already done that. A brand site argues for one option and has an obvious interest in the conclusion.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;One overlooked source of fragmentation is internal. Companies with several divisions, regional offices or acquired brands frequently publish under variant names without anyone deciding to, and the resulting record describes something that looks like three loosely related organisations. Deciding which entities should be distinct and which should be one, then enforcing it, is a governance question rather than a marketing one and it usually needs somebody senior to settle.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;What Brands Usually Get Wrong in Response The instinctive response is to publish more brand content, which addresses none of the above. The second instinct is to try to displace the review site, which is not achievable and would not help if it were.&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;&amp;lt;br&amp;gt;Read the answers for confidence rather than accuracy at first.
